Internet troll who threatened to kill JK Rowling spared jail

Jun 05, 2024

London [UK], June 5: An internet troll who posted "chilling" online messages threatening to kill "Harry Potter" author JK Rowling and former Labour Member of Parliament (MP) Rosie Duffield has been spared jail. Glenn Mullen, 31, uploaded audio clips in Gaelic threatening to kill Rowling "with a big hammer" and said he was "going to see Rosie Duffield at the bar with a big gun," Westminster Magistrates' Court in London heard on Tuesday. Mullen had been publicly identified as the poster of the audio clips by an online magazine shortly after they were posted on social media site X in January 2023, the court was told. He admitted the offences, two charges of sending an article conveying threatening messages, at an earlier hearing. (DPA)
